refer to the diagram above. correctly name the plane. choose all that apply. select all correct options plane bfd plane efc plane abc plane z
Brief Explanations
A plane can be named using three non-collinear points that lie on it, or a single capital letter assigned to the plane.
- Plane BFD: Points B, F, D are non-collinear and lie on the plane, so this is valid.
- Plane EFC: Points E, F, C are non-collinear and lie on the plane, so this is valid.
- Plane ABC: Points A, B, C are non-collinear and lie on the plane, so this is valid.
- Plane Z: The diagram shows the plane is labeled Z, so this is valid.
